Abstract:

This study investigates how bank expertise in identifying productive projects shapes economic structures. Utilizing the U.S. interstate banking deregulation of the 1980s as a quasi-natural experiment, we find that deregulation facilitated the convergence of economic structures across states. This effect is particularly pronounced among state pairs with significantly different pre-deregulation economic structures or when one state depends on external finance while the other is more financially developed. We then develop a general equilibrium model embedded in a Lucas-island framework featuring imperfect searching and matching between banks and firms. Calibrated to U.S. data, our model accounts for approximately half of the observed convergence of economic structures between service- and manufacturing-dominated states following deregulation. Furthermore, while deregulation enhances welfare, banks may deviate from the socially optimal level of entry, either under- or over-penetrating markets, due to pricing power and labor displacement effects. The extent of these deviations is determined by banks’ entry costs and market concentration.

Speaker's Profile:

Dr. Yu Yi is an Assistant Professor at the Nankai University. He earned his Ph.D. in Economics from the London School of Economics and Political Science in 2023. Before that, he earned his Msc in EME from LSE, and B.A. in Economics and B.S. in mathematics from Wuhan University. His research interests include macro finance and banking. He was awarded the Rising Star Award by the Chinese Economic Society in 2023.
